P Diddy's rise to fame was meteoric, driven by his ability to produce chart-topping hits and collaborate with some of the most talented artists of his time. His debut album, "No Way Out," released in 1997, catapulted him into the spotlight, earning him widespread acclaim and commercial success. The album featured hit singles like "I'll Be Missing You," a tribute to The Notorious B.I.G., which topped the Billboard Hot 100 chart for 11 weeks.

However, it was the founding of his own record label, Bad Boy Records, in 1993 that marked a turning point in his career. With artists like The Notorious B.I.G., Faith Evans, and Mase, Bad Boy Records became a powerhouse in the music industry, producing chart-topping hits and shaping the sound of 1990s hip hop and R&B.
Sean Combs was born and raised in Harlem, New York City, during a tumultuous time marked by social and economic challenges. Despite these obstacles, he exhibited an early interest in music and entrepreneurship. His mother, Janice Combs, played a pivotal role in nurturing his talents and instilling in him the values of hard work and perseverance.

Throughout his career, P Diddy has supported numerous political campaigns and initiatives aimed at increasing voter awareness and participation. His "Vote or Die!" campaign during the 2004 presidential election was one such effort, designed to mobilize young voters and encourage civic engagement.
